In many enterprise workflows, classification sounds simple. An email arrives. A ticket is created. A request needs to be routed. At first glance, it feels like a straightforward model problem: classify the input assign a category trigger the next step But in practice, enterprise classification is rarely just about model accuracy. It is also about: latency cost governance data sensitivity operational fit fallback behavior That is where the architecture becomes more important than the model itself.
